Monaco Team Overview
These guys are incredible. For the second year in a row, the "Monegasques" are at the top of the standings. Most likely, the reason lies in their sporting audacity. The team knows how to play fast, with a good number of skilled basketball players in the lineup. They don't always win, and setbacks do happen, but it doesn't affect them in the long run. The arrival of Nick Calathes in the offseason added logic to their actions, and his partnership with Mike James instills fear in many. Monaco occupies fourth place in the regular season. There is an opportunity to climb higher, so no one plans to stop.
